UK Confirms Mandatory Levy and Stake Caps on Online Slots

The UK Department for Digital, Culture, Media & Sport has confirmed plans to implement a mandatory levy on all licensed gambling operators, aiming to raise approximately £100 million annually for responsible gambling research and treatment programs. The voluntary contribution scheme will be replaced, making all operators accountable.

Additionally, the government will cap online slot stakes at £5 per spin for players over 25, and £2 for those aged 18–24—a significant step to limit gambling harm among vulnerable demographics. These measures aim to balance revenue generation with consumer protection.

Gambling Minister Baroness Twycross emphasized the urgency of these reforms, citing the social and financial damage caused by excessive gambling. The enforced levy and stake limits highlight the UK’s commitment to tackling gambling-related harms systemically.

Operators now face the dual challenge of adjusting business models to meet regulatory compliance while maintaining competitive appeal in a rapidly evolving digital gambling landscape.
